Inspired by Chuy’s Mexi-Cobb Salad this entrée salad is loaded with roasted hatch green chile peppers, grilled chicken, avocado, tomatoes, cheese and topped off with a spicy ranch!

My favorite thing to order at Chuy’s is their Mexi-Cobb Salad. I had just a couple roasted hatch green chiles left and decided to make my own version of that dish at home.
This recipe is ideal for late summer during hatch green chile season. Grill up a chicken breast or use leftover fajita chicken. Makes a healthy southwestern entrée salad that comes together in no time!

Ingredients
- Spring Mix – Or a combination of romaine and green leaf lettuce.
- Roasted Hatch Green Chile Peppers - Use one to two depending on personal preference.
- Avocado – One small avocado.
- Tomatoes – I like to use cherry tomatoes in my salads but roma will work too.
- Grilled Chicken – This is the perfect recipe for leftover grilled fajita chicken.
- Shredded Mexican Blend Cheese – Chuy’s does not skimp on their shredded cheese so I do not recommend skipping. It makes the salad very filling.
- Spicy Ranch Dressing – Try out my homemade Hatch Green Chile Ranch Dressing or just buy your favorite store-bought Jalapeno Ranch.
How To Make
- Layer half the spring mix in each bowl. Top with hatch green chile, avocado, tomatoes, grilled chicken and cheese.
- Serve with Hatch Green Chile Ranch Dressing or your favorite spicy ranch!

Storage & Serving
This salad is best enjoyed the day it is made. If you would like to meal prep this, it is best to keep the ingredients separate until the end.

Southwest Grilled Chicken and Green Chile Salad
Greens topped with fajita chicken, roasted hatch chiles, avocado, cherry tomatoes, cheese and topped with a spicy ranch!
Ingredients
- 6 cups Spring Mix
- 1-2 whole Roasted Hatch Green Chiles seeded and chopped
- 1 small Avocado sliced
- ½ cup Cherry Tomatoes
- ¼ cup Mexican Blend Shredded Cheese
- 6 - 8 oz. Grilled Chicken
- 4 tbsp. Spicy Ranch
Instructions
- Layer half the spring mix in each bowl. Top each bowl with half of the hatch green chiles, avocado, tomatoes, grilled chicken and cheese.
- Serve with Hatch Green Chile Ranch Dressing or your favorite spicy ranch!
